Rumored Buzz on what is md5's application

Most of the time, the passwords you utilize in your favorites Web sites aren't saved in plain textual content. They're initially hashed for security good reasons.

Information Integrity Verification: MD5 is frequently used to check the integrity of documents. When a file is transferred, its MD5 hash might be compared prior to and following the transfer to make certain it has not been altered.

We will need to complete the calculation in techniques, mainly because this on the internet calculator for reasonable expressions doesn’t allow parentheses for purchasing the operations. Let’s get started by locating the results of the 1st portion:

Employing features I and II, we complete sixteen rounds utilizing since the First vector the output of the preceding sixteen rounds. This tends to end in modified values of the,b,c, and d in Every spherical.

Provided the vulnerabilities of MD5, safer hash functions at the moment are advised for cryptographic purposes:

Pre-impression assaults purpose to locate an input that matches a specified hash value. Provided an MD5 hash, an attacker can hire numerous strategies, which include brute drive or rainbow tables, to locate an input that hashes on the concentrate on value.

No, MD5 is just not secure for storing passwords. It is prone to different attacks, which include brute power and rainbow desk assaults. Rather, It is really advisable to make use of salted hashing algorithms like bcrypt or Argon2 for password storage.

The 64th Procedure proceeds like Every of Those people ahead of it, using the outputs with the 63rd operation as its initialization vectors with the I operate. When it has undergone Every with the measures of your operation, it gives us new values for the, B, C and D.

Which means two data files with completely distinct written content will never possess the similar MD5 digest, rendering it extremely unlikely for somebody to crank out a fake file that matches the original digest.

It’s okay, Now we have begun with a tough and simplistic overview that only aims to here give you an define of the various methods involved in MD5. In the subsequent section, We are going to walk by way of each Section of the process in increased element

For the remaining of the box, we see an arrow with Mi pointing toward it in addition. These represent our two inputs in another calculation.

The brand new values for B, C and D are set in the F perform in the identical way as while in the prior Procedure.

Malware Evaluation: In malware analysis, MD5 hashes ended up accustomed to identify known malware variants. By evaluating the MD5 hash of a suspicious file that has a database of recognised malicious hashes, analysts could immediately flag likely threats.

MD5 is prone to collision attacks, where two distinctive inputs make the identical hash, and pre-image assaults, in which an attacker can reverse the hash to find the first input.

Leave a Reply

Your email address will not be published. Required fields are marked *